目录
引言
在使用网络代理工具的过程中,许多用户可能会遇到一个问题:clash能用vmess吗?本篇文章将详细探讨clash与vmess协议的兼容性,帮助用户更好地配置与使用这两者。
什么是clash
clash是一款强大的网络代理客户端,支持多种代理协议,如Shadowsocks、Vmess、Trojan等,广泛应用于翻墙、网络加速等场景。它具有配置灵活、界面友好等特点,支持多平台使用,尤其在Windows、macOS和Linux等系统上表现出色。
什么是vmess协议
Vmess协议是一种由V2Ray开发的代理协议,主要用于实现数据的加密传输。它可以有效绕过网络限制,保障用户上网的隐私与安全。vmess协议相比其他协议(如Shadowsocks)更加稳定和灵活,支持更加复杂的网络配置。
clash支持vmess协议吗?
答案是肯定的,clash完全支持vmess协议。作为一款多协议支持的网络代理工具,clash能够无缝地集成vmess协议,用户只需通过正确配置,即可利用vmess协议进行代理连接。
支持vmess的好处
- 稳定性:vmess协议经过多年的优化,稳定性较高,能够在复杂的网络环境下正常工作。
- 安全性:vmess协议采用了加密技术,保障用户的数据传输安全。
- 灵活性:vmess支持多种不同的配置,能够根据用户需求调整网络连接方式。
如何在clash中配置vmess
在clash中配置vmess协议其实并不复杂,以下是详细的配置步骤:
步骤一:下载并安装clash
- 访问clash的官方网站,下载适合自己操作系统的版本。
- 完成安装后,打开clash客户端。
步骤二:获取vmess节点信息
vmess节点信息通常由第三方代理提供商提供,包含以下内容:
- 服务器地址:例如
example.com
- 端口号:例如
443
- UUID:用户的唯一标识符,确保数据传输安全。
- AlterID:用于增加连接的安全性,防止被识别。
- 加密方式:通常为
aes-128-gcm
等。
步骤三:在clash中配置vmess节点
- 打开clash,进入配置界面。
- 点击
配置文件
,并选择编辑
。 - 将从代理服务商获取的vmess节点信息填入配置文件中。
- 保存并重新加载配置,确保设置生效。
步骤四:启动并测试连接
- 配置完成后,启动clash代理客户端。
- 在浏览器或其他应用中进行测试,确保vmess协议能够正常工作。
clash与vmess协议的兼容性问题
尽管clash支持vmess协议,但在某些情况下,用户可能会遇到兼容性问题。以下是一些常见的问题及解决方法:
问题一:vmess节点无法连接
解决方法:检查节点信息是否正确,特别是UUID和AlterID。确认服务器地址、端口是否与代理服务提供商提供的一致。
问题二:clash连接速度较慢
解决方法:尝试切换至其他vmess节点,或优化本地网络环境。此外,vmess协议的加密方式可能会影响连接速度,可以根据实际需要选择适当的加密方式。
问题三:clash无法解析vmess配置文件
解决方法:确保配置文件格式正确,避免出现语法错误。可以参考官方文档进行配置。
常见问题FAQ
1. clash可以同时支持多个协议吗?
是的,clash支持多个协议的同时使用,包括vmess、Shadowsocks、Trojan等。用户可以根据需要灵活选择协议。
2. vmess协议安全吗?
vmess协议是一种加密协议,能够有效保障用户数据传输的安全性。与其他协议相比,vmess在隐私保护和数据加密方面具有优势。
3. 如何提高clash的连接速度?
提高连接速度可以从多个方面入手,包括选择更优质的vmess节点、优化本地网络环境、调整代理设置等。
4. 如何使用clash与vmess协议进行科学上网?
通过在clash中配置vmess节点,用户可以实现科学上网。配置完成后,只需启动clash客户端,即可在浏览器或其他应用中访问被墙的网站。
5. vmess与Shadowsocks有什么区别?
vmess和Shadowsocks都属于代理协议,但vmess相比Shadowsocks具有更高的灵活性和安全性。vmess支持多种加密方式,而Shadowsocks的加密方式较为单一。
结语
本文详细介绍了clash是否可以使用vmess协议以及如何在clash中配置vmess节点。通过合理配置,用户可以充分发挥clash和vmess的优势,提升上网体验。希望本文能够帮助你更好地理解clash和vmess协议,并顺利进行配置和使用。